  1. José Mário dos Santos Mourinho Félix GOIH (European Portuguese: [ʒuˈzɛ moˈɾiɲu] ⓘ; born 26 January 1963), is a Portuguese professional football manager and former player who was most recently head coach of Italian Serie A club Roma.

  7. May 4, 2021 · The former Tottenham and Inter Milan manager has signed a three-year deal with the three-time Serie A champions. He replaces Paulo Fonseca, who will leave at the end of the current season. Mourinho has won four major trophies with Inter and Real Madrid, and aims to build a winning project with Roma.
